Delhi Capitals have suffered a major blow ahead of IPL 2025 as Harry Brook has withdrawn from the tournament due to unknown reasons. The English batter, who was bought for ₹6.25 crore, was expected to play a key role in DC’s middle order. Now, the franchise will need to find a suitable overseas replacement.

Here are three potential candidates who could replace Harry Brook in Delhi Capitals’ IPL 2025 squad:

1.Dewald Brevis

The South African youngster Dewald Brevis, popularly known as ‘Baby AB’, is another exciting option. Although he hasn’t fully lived up to expectations, he has shown signs of maturity and growth as a batter.

Brevis is a powerful hitter who has batted in positions ranging from No. 1 to No. 7, providing Delhi Capitals the flexibility they need in a high-pressure tournament like the IPL. His past experience with Mumbai Indians (MI) in IPL 2022 and 2024 could also work in his favor.

2. Ben Duckett

Another strong contender is England’s Ben Duckett, who has been in sublime form across formats. Duckett was a key performer in the Champions Trophy 2025 and has prior experience of playing in Indian conditions.

Duckett’s ability to play spin well gives him an edge over many English players. He can open or play in the middle order, making him a strong replacement for Brook.

3.Daryl Mitchell

New Zealand’s Daryl Mitchell stands out as a top choice due to his versatility and ability to bat anywhere in the order. Mitchell has consistently performed in T20Is and IPL, making him a strong candidate.

In IPL 2024, playing for CSK, Mitchell scored 318 runs in 13 innings at an average of 28.90 and a strike rate of 142.60. Additionally, he can bowl part-time medium pace, making him a valuable all-round option for Delhi Capitals.

Who will replace Harry Brook in DC’s squad?

With Brook’s withdrawal, Delhi Capitals will have to make a strategic decision regarding his replacement. While Mitchell provides stability and all-round skills, Duckett brings consistency, and Brevis offers explosive power and versatility. DC’s final choice could depend on their squad balance and the type of batter they need in the middle order.
